There are five basic varieties of scalar datatypes: character datatypes, numeric datatypes, datetime datatypes, large object (LOB) datatypes, and datatypes that represent other types of data. This appendix summarizes the characteristics of each of these varieties.
Unless otherwise noted, all scalar datatypes described in the following sections are valid for both the database and for PL/SQL declarations. (Note, however, that some of the datatypes listed under “Collection Datatypes” later in this appendix are valid only for PL/SQL.)
